FANUC is the leader in robotics, CNCs, and ROBOMACHINEs with over 25 million products installed worldwide. We offer an extensive range of robot models with an intuitive user interface providing easy setup, programming and operation. Intelligent features such as integrated Force Sensing, iRVision® ROBOGUIDE simulation and Industrial IoT solutions like Zero Down Time (ZDT) help customers achieve their automation goals.  From small shops to large production and fulfillment operations, companies rely on FANUC automation to maximize productivity, quality, and profitability.

FANUC’s robots are reliable, flexible and able to handle payloads from 0.5kg. to 2,300 kg., including: the CRX-10iA collaborative robot that sets new standards in ease of use, safety and reliability; the food-safe DR-3iB/8L delta robot for primary and secondary food packaging;  six SCARA robot models including two environmental options rated IP65; the LR Mate series of tabletop robots including ISO Class 4 cleanroom and food-grade variants;  and the long-standing M-410iC series of high-speed palletizing robots.
